Industrial Systems Tech Instructor

Remote, USA Full-time Posted 2025-05-22

Savannah Technical College is seeking a full-time Industrial Systems Program Instructor at its Savannah Campus. This position is responsible for teaching students in classroom and lab environments.Responsibilities


  • Duties include a flexible schedule of lecture, lesson planning, student advisement and registration, which may involve split teaching shifts, teaching day/evening classes and/or travel to multiple campuses.

  • Instructs students, evaluates and records student progress in attaining goals and objectives.

  • Advises/counsels students, maintains appropriate student records on each student; provides student registration assistance.

  • Recruits new students into the Industrial Systems Technology Program and manages student retention.

  • Ensures compliance with accreditation standards of regional and national accrediting agencies.

  • Ensures safety requirements are met in the classroom and laboratory environments.

  • Completes reports and responds to requests for information from internal and external departments and agencies.

  • Monitors student use of supplies, materials and equipment. Reports inventory and orders supplies/equipment as necessary.

  • May serve on committees and/or work on projects with other instructional departments/divisions and school-wide planning.

  • Performs other duties as assigned by the Dean of Industrial Technology.

  • Follows all policies and procedures of Savannah Technical College.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Associate's Degree in Industrial Systems Technology or related field from an accredited college or university and a minimum of two (2) documented work experience in the Industrial Systems field or 5+ years industry experience.

  • Additional work experience may be considered in lieu of degree on a year for year basis.

  • Must demonstrate excellent written and oral communication skills along with computer skills.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Teaching experience at a post-secondary institution is desirable.

  • Experience with Mechatronics and Robotics.

  • Experience with drones.

  • Supervisory experience.

Physical Demands:Teaching responsibilities are typically performed in a classroom/lab environment with the employee intermittently sitting, standing, walking, bending, pushing, and puling for three (3) – four (4) continuous hours at a time. The employee frequently lifts lightweight objects up to 50LBS. The work is performed in campus buildings and outdoors where the employee is occasionally exposed to cold or inclement weather. The exposure to dirt, dust, grease, machinery with moving parts, chemicals, and fumes is possible in the laboratory environment. The ability to distinguish colors is required for purposes of electrical wiring.
